目的:对注射用氟罗沙星原料的合成工艺进行探讨研究。方法:以6,7,8 - 三氟-1,4 - 二氢-4- 氧喹啉-3- 羧酸乙酯为原料,经4 步反应得到氟罗沙星。结果:本品的元素分析、红外、质谱、核磁共振图谱数据与文献报道一致,总收率为56-3% ,产品经质量测定,完全符合注射用原料的标准。结论:采用该路线工艺生产的氟罗沙星原料产品符合注射用原料的标准,可直接用于注射剂的生产。
Objective: To study the synthesis process of fleroxacin raw material for injection. Methods: Flefloxacin was obtained from 4,7 - trifluoro - 1, 4 - dihydro - 4 - oxoquinoline - 3 - carboxylic acid ethyl ester by 4 steps. Results: The elemental analysis, infrared, mass spectrometry and nuclear magnetic resonance spectroscopy data were consistent with those reported in the literature. The total yield was 56-3%. The product was determined by quality and fully met the standard of raw materials for injection. Conclusion: The raw materials of fleroxacin produced by this route are in line with the standard of raw materials for injection and can be directly used for the production of injection.
